I only just expanded my flock on the weekend, purchasing some more pure breds, then on Monday my Langshan rooster approx 12 weeks old who i hatched here has gone in the legs. He just sits there, resting on one side. My whole flock was hatched here on the farm, i have about 50 young chicks including my newly purchased Favorelles, Australorps, Wyandottes, and the Langshans i've had since xmas time. I'm REALLY worried about my pure breds, is there any way to tell th difference between the disease and the deficiency, the vets up here don't seem to have a clue about chickens. PLEASE HELP?

Hi luvmychooks,

Sorry to hear about your rooster - hopefully it's not Marek's.

The most important thing is to isolate the new birds from your young ones, and also isolate any of your young ones (apart from the rest of your flock and the new birds) that show symptoms of any illness. Quarantining seems to be so important.

Somebody with more experience may be able to offer more information on the differences. Sudden onset does sound a bit suspicious. I haven't had first-hand experience with Marek's - I had a young pullet who "went in the legs" but she just sat back on her haunches rather than lay down with legs out to the side. She has recovered pretty well (took a couple of months) so not sure if hers was rickets or an injury - shouldn't have been Marek's as she was vaccinated with the other young ones as a day-old.
